Resumo:
This study aimed to install a repertoire adequate to the class formation of olfactory stimuli in three domestic dogs through training repeated yoked reversals of simple discriminations in three phases: (1) with two stimuli (2) in pairs with two sets of stimuli, and (3) with four stimuli. The subjects learned the tasks in Phases 1 and 2, and two of them showed learning set of the task in Phase 1; but none responded in a way befitting the formation of classes. It is argued that the requirement to discriminating four stimuli in the same trial may have disrupted training, and a new study is suggested to deal with this difficulty.
